How to Grow Teff in Tennessee

Teff (Eragrostis tef) is a highly nutritious, gluten-free grain that has gained popularity due to its health benefits and suitability for various cuisines. Originally from Ethiopia, it has become an increasingly attractive crop for American farmers, including those in Tennessee. Growing teff in Tennessee presents unique challenges and opportunities, making it essential for farmers to understand the specific requirements needed to cultivate this ancient grain effectively.

What is Teff?

Teff is an annual grass that produces tiny seeds, which are rich in protein, fiber, and essential vitamins and minerals. It has a high nutritional value and is often used to make injera, a traditional Ethiopian flatbread. Teff is known for its adaptability to various climates and soils, making it a versatile crop for agricultural practices.

Soil Preparation

Proper soil preparation is crucial for successful teff cultivation.

Soil Type

Teff prefers well-drained loamy or sandy soils with good fertility. Heavy clay soils should be avoided as they may retain too much moisture and hinder root development.

Soil pH

The ideal soil pH range for teff is between 5.8 and 7.0. Conduct a soil test to determine your soil’s pH level and nutrient content before planting.

Amendments

Based on your soil test results, consider adding organic matter such as compost or well-rotted manure to improve soil fertility and drainage. Additionally, you may need to add lime or sulfur to adjust pH levels accordingly.

Planting Teff

Planting teff requires careful planning to ensure optimal germination and growth.

Timing

In Tennessee, the best time to plant teff is typically between mid-May and early June when the soil temperature reaches at least 65°F. This will provide enough warmth for seed germination.

Seed Selection

Choose high-quality certified seeds from reputable suppliers. Teff seeds are tiny (about 1/16 inch in diameter), so precise planting techniques are essential.

Seeding Rate

A typical seeding rate for teff is about 10-15 pounds per acre when using a seed drill or broadcast method. If planting by hand, consider thinning out seedlings after germination to avoid overcrowding.

Planting Depth

Plant teff seeds at a depth of 1/8 to 1/4 inch. Ensure that seeds are covered lightly with soil as they require light for germination.

Weed Management

Weed control is vital during the early stages of teff growth when plants are still establishing themselves.

Cultural Practices

Utilize practices such as crop rotation, intercropping, and maintaining good soil health to reduce weed competition naturally.

Mechanical Control

Consider using shallow tillage or hoeing as necessary during the first few weeks post-planting. Avoid deep tillage that could disturb roots.

Herbicides

If weed pressure becomes excessive, consult with agricultural extension services regarding suitable herbicides that are safe for use on teff crops.

Fertilization Practices

Teff has moderate nutrient needs but responds well to fertilization:

Nitrogen Application

Consider applying nitrogen at a rate of about 40-60 pounds per acre based on your soil test results. Split applications – one at planting and another during early growth – can optimize uptake.

Potassium and Phosphorus

Incorporate potassium (K) and phosphorus (P) based on the results of your soil test; these nutrients play vital roles in plant health and development.

Harvesting Teff

Timely harvesting ensures optimal yield and quality:

Signs of Maturity

Teff typically matures about 60-90 days after planting. Look for yellow-brown color changes in the seed heads and dry foliage as indicators that it’s time to harvest.

Harvesting Method

Teff can be harvested using a small combine harvester or manually with sickles if cultivated on a smaller scale. Be cautious not to damage the fragile seed heads during this process.

Drying and Storage

After harvesting, allow the seeds to dry completely before storage. Store dried grains in airtight containers in a cool, dry place to prevent spoilage or insect infestations.
